Keppel Corp has slashed 20,000 jobs from its offshore workforce in less than two years, highlighting the impact the crisis has had on the flagship Singapore rig builder.

Chief executive Loh Chin Hua, speaking to analysts after its third quarter results, said the workforce has gone from 36,000 at the start of 2015 to just 16,000 today.

He said Keppel O&M will continue its efforts to optimise operations and manage costs tightly even as it builds new capabilities and expands into new markets.
